I have the "bronze" variety (although, I think it could be the "red" one). I planted it in a 20L tank with 1.8wpg light, no ferts, no CO2 (not even Excel). They just grow and grow and grow! Very pretty color, as well.
I've harvested some for my 75g tank with 2.44wpg, EI ferts and injected CO2, and it's growing very well there, too.
It does appear to grow taller, more upright in lower light while it stays lower, more horizontal in bright light. It also seems to have more color in lower light, but that may be due to the bottom of the leaves not showing as much in high light.
I disagree with the person who said it is a difficult plant to transplant. This is a really tough plant that will thrive where most other plants refuse to grow. If you have to transplant it, trim the roots to about 2" and plant. I have not had them show any ill effects from this. They regrow their roots quickly and continue on as if nothing ever happened. Sometimes one or two of the bottom leaves will melt, but that's it.
